Lucy Bucchiere Obituary

Of Saugus, Aug. 31. Wife of the late Saugus Police Officer Rosario A. "Roy" Bucchiere. Loving mother of Julia Rea of Saugus, Lucille Ventre and her husband Jerome of Saugus, Michael Bucchiere of Peabody & his late wife Claire, Roy Bucchiere & his wife Elizabeth of Swampscott, Francis Bucchiere & his wife Carolyn of Saugus, John Bucchiere & his wife Mary of Saugus, David Bucchiere and his partner John Hooker of Phoenix, AZ. Sister of Frank Coscia of NH & Margaret Fasano of Saugus. Sister in-law of Marion Sacca of Winchester. Also survived by 17 grandchildren, 22 great grandchildren & 10 great great grandchildren. The Funeral will be held from the Bisbee-Porcella Funeral Home, 549 Lincoln Ave., SAUGUS, Wednesday at 9 a.m., followed by a funeral mass at St. Margaret's Church, 431 Lincoln Ave., Saugus at 10 a.m. Relatives and friends invited. Visiting hours Tuesday 2-4 & 7-9 p.m. Interment Riverside Cemetery, Saugus. Donations in her memory may be made to the American Heart Assoc., Ma. Affiliate, Inc., 20 Speen St., Framingham, MA 01701.
